Regularly Eat Fruits and Vegetables
When eaten in large quantities, the fluids of fruits and vegetables can help rehydrate a person. Eat watery fruits like watermelon and pineapple for the most rehydration since they contain high amounts of water to maintain their freshness.
Vegetables such as cucumber and celery are over 95 percent water, making them great foods to slice into pieces and eat with a side of hummus for a hydrating snack. Reduce How Much You Sweat
Sweating is a primary cause of dehydration during the summer. If you don’t rehydrate after sweating extensively, you’ll feel more tired from the lack of water in the blood. Sweat occurs when our bodies become too hot from an external heat source, such as the sun, and we need to cool down. Our bodies produce sweat as a cooling process to prevent our skin from overheating.
Wearing sunblock will prevent the sun’s rays from heating your skin and act as a protective layer to prevent sunburn. Stay close to the shade, and don’t feel obligated to go outside when the temperature is high and the sun is out. Fatigue is one of the most common ways dehydration will affect your daily life. After all, you won’t have the energy to enjoy the summer when you feel too fatigued to move and constantly need to cool down.
Drink Water With Every Meal
Water is a valuable resource for all life, and it will prevent dehydration in the warmest conditions. Drinking water with every meal is the simplest way to stay hydrated during the summer.
Since you eat multiple times throughout the day, drink a cup of water with each meal to wash down your food and keep yourself hydrated. This method of staying hydrated is especially useful during the summer when most people are active and burn more calories. You’ll likely eat more, and your water intake will improve with more meals.
